#ifndef SHARE_GC_SERIAL_SERIALHEAP_HPP
#define SHARE_GC_SERIAL_SERIALHEAP_HPP

#include "gc/serial/defNewGeneration.hpp"
#include "gc/serial/tenuredGeneration.hpp"
#include "gc/shared/genCollectedHeap.hpp"
#include "utilities/growableArray.hpp"

class GCMemoryManager;
class MemoryPool;
class TenuredGeneration;

class SerialHeap : public GenCollectedHeap {
private:
  MemoryPool* _eden_pool;
  MemoryPool* _survivor_pool;
  MemoryPool* _old_pool;

  virtual void initialize_serviceability();

public:
  static SerialHeap* heap();

  SerialHeap();

  virtual Name kind() const {
    return CollectedHeap::Serial;
  }

  virtual const char* name() const {
    return "Serial";
  }

  virtual GrowableArray<GCMemoryManager*> memory_managers();
  virtual GrowableArray<MemoryPool*> memory_pools();

  DefNewGeneration* young_gen() const {
    assert(_young_gen->kind() == Generation::DefNew, "Wrong generation type");
    return static_cast<DefNewGeneration*>(_young_gen);
  }

  TenuredGeneration* old_gen() const {
    assert(_old_gen->kind() == Generation::MarkSweepCompact, "Wrong generation type");
    return static_cast<TenuredGeneration*>(_old_gen);
  }

  // Apply "cur->do_oop" or "older->do_oop" to all the oops in objects
  // allocated since the last call to save_marks in the young generation.
  // The "cur" closure is applied to references in the younger generation
  // at "level", and the "older" closure to older generations.
  template <typename OopClosureType1, typename OopClosureType2>
  void oop_since_save_marks_iterate(OopClosureType1* cur,
                                    OopClosureType2* older);
};

#endif // SHARE_GC_SERIAL_SERIALHEAP_HPP
